Britain's Got Talent goes live!
 
 

Britain's Got Talent will be taking to stage for a nationwide tour, it has been confirmed.

The winner and finalists from this year's hit ITV1 talent search will all take part in Britain's Got Talent Live, which kicks off at London's Hammersmith Apollo on Friday June 6, 2008.

Hosted by Stephen Mulhern, presenter of ITV2's behind-the-scenes show Britain's Got More Talent, the tour will visit 13 cities including audition hotspots Liverpool, Manchester, Birmingham, Cardiff and Glasgow.

Paul Potts became an overnight star after winning the first series of Britain's Got Talent last year - and the second series is proving as popular as ever with more than 10 million tuning into the show's launch at the start of April.

Featuring singers, dancers and comedians, the live show promises to be a must-see for all the family - and tickets are already in high demand.
